COURSE DESCRIPTION
Course Level Bachelor's Degree
Course Type Elective
Course Objective The aim of the course is to find numerical solutions to physical problems which can not be found an analytical solution.
Course Content Molecular Dynamics, Potential Energy Functions, Algorithms for Molecular Dynamics, Molecular Dynamic Methods for Statistical Ensemble, Applications.
Prerequisites No the prerequisite of lesson.
Corequisite No the corequisite of lesson.
Mode of Delivery Face to Face
